Game Background
Ocarina of Time is the fifth game in series to be released but isn't a sequel to any of the four previous ones and is the prequel to Majora's Mask and The Wind Waker. -

Introduction
The game follows Link, a young boy who is destined to become a hero. He ventures the world Hyrule in order to stop evil Ganondorf, King of Gerudo, from obtaining the Triforce, the sacred relic which grants wishes to it's holder. Controls
- Analog stick - Link moves; aim weapons
- Button A - Link performs an action - jumps; rolls; advances dialogue
- Button B - Sword attack, cancel; skip dialog; save (on the pause menu)
- Holding the B button - Sword spin, if magic available - charge sword spin
- Button R - Activate shield stance
- Button L - Show map
- Button Z - Target enemy, NPC, focus the camera behind Link
- Top C Button - First-person view
- Right, Left, Down C Button - Use assigned items
- Start - Pauses the game, opens menu
The Beginning - Kokiri Woods
- The game begins with a cut scene in which we meet Link, the game's main protagonist.
- Watch the cut scene. After it ends, you get control of Link. Move him using the analog stick and exit the house.
- Link will talk to Saria. If you try to go to Deku Tree - the big wide thing on the map, you'll only find out that you can't exit the place as long as you don't have a sword and a shield. Your next objective is to get them.
- Check your map. Go to the western area of town, up the fencing hill. The place is called Forest Training Center. Find your way through fences and a small hole in the end. Enter it by pressing A. After you're there on the other side prepare to run behind the moving boulder. After the boulder passes just run behind it. Go to the left, then to the right. You'll see a chest, press A to open it. Congratulations, you just found your first sword.
- Exit the place same way you entered it. Play with the sword a bit. Press B to attack. Get some rupees by cutting grass, throwing stones etc. To grab items, just approach them and press A. Press B to throw them. A quick way to earn some rupees is by jumping across the platforms in the water near the shop.
- Once you got 40 rupees, enter the shop. Buy the Deku Shield and don't forget to equip it. You can equip it on the start menu - press Start to enter it.
- Go to Mido, this time he'll let you pass. Just follow the way, kill some creatures with your newly acquired sword. Grab some Deku Sticks and meet the Deku Tree.
- Watch the cut scene. Enter the tree's mouth.
Inside the Deku Tree
- You enter a large area infested by monsters. The enemies you see near the starting point are Deku Babas. Attack them, you should get some Deku Nuts and Deku Sticks but keep in mind that these enemies will regenerate.
- TIP: Always cut the grass! Cutting the grass will earn you some easy money + you get the hearts to replenish your health.
- The only way is to go up. Climb the wines. After you're on top, keep heading right. On the way, you'll find a chest which contains Dungeon map. Every dungeon has these.
- Enter the door on the end of the path. Inside is the monster that will spill nuts at you. You need to deflect these to his face using the shield - pressing R. After that's been done, just run to him. When caught, he'll unlock the door. Enter the room.
- Jump across the platforms - quickly. On the other side you'll find a chest with Fairy Slingshot. Equip it. Turn around and look at the unreachable door. Use the slingshot to hit the ladder. It will fall down and enable you to get back to the main room.
- TIP: When attacking the enemies, focus on them by holding the Z button. This will enable you to auto-aim your slingshot shots too.
- Go down a bit to the place where you can see some vines. You can climb on the wall. However before you try to climb it use the slingshot to attack spiders crawling on the wall. Now you can use the vines to get to the upper floor. Go to the right, ignore the big spiders and enter the door.
- Jump on the button to bring the platforms up. Quickly jump over the platforms to get to the opposite side. There you'll find the Compass. It will reveal the locations of all unopened chests and the location of dungeon's boss. If you jump from the platforms on the enclave on the left you'll mark how a spider - Skulltula appears down the ceiling. Kill him by using the slingshot and get the token. These will be used later in the game but are fully optional. To exit the room equip the Deku Stick and get it near the burning torch. Now, go to the door and open the passage. Be careful that your Deku Stick does not burn away.
- Now go to one of the three openings in the spider web. A big spider will appear. Don't attack him until he turns his back to you. Then attack and kill him. Peer over the edge back to the first floor. Jump over the edge - you'll land on a big spiderweb in the first room of the dungeon. If done correctly, you'll fall through it and find yourself in a new room.
- Climb onto the ledge with the button switch. Use the switch to light the torch behind you. Light your Deku Stick and get it through the shallow water to the other side. Light the spider web and get through the door. Note: On the web to get to the upper floor there is another Skulltula. The third one is on the watergate. Kill it with slingshot.
- TIP: You'll know when a Skulltula enemy is close by hearing the noise he makes when Link is close to him. It's a sound of a spider crawling.
- In the new room there is another deku monster. Just use the shield to reflect the nuts back to him. Catch him and he'll tell you the way to defeat his brothers - 2-3-1. That's the order you'll have to defeat them in, from right to left. Use your slingshot to shoot the eye switch above the locked door.
- As you enter the next room Navi will tell you about diving. Get in water, dive and press the switch to lower the water level. Even if it's timed, don't worry, you'll have enough time to get to the other side. Defeat the spider. Move to block under the door and climb it. In the next room kill the Babas light the unlit torches and proceed to the next room.
- IBe careful around the enemies. Larvas will drop if you run underneath them. Light the torch and fire the webs. One will lead to a dead end and another to a crawlspace. Go through the crawlspace to reach a room you were previous in. Move the block into the water and use the newly created bridge to get to the other side. Light your Deku Stick and get to the web fast. Roll over it to put it on fire. You'll finish up in the lowest level of the dungeon.
- Defeat the Deku things in the order you were told before. You remember? It's 2-3-1. You'll get a hint about the boss. If you're ready. Proceed to the next room. Now it gets merry.
- To damage Gohma you'll need to wait until he falls on the ground and opens his eye. When the eye is red use a slingshot to hit it. You'll stun him. Now it's time to attack with your sword. Hit his eye as many times as you can. When he gets to the ceiling try to hit his eye there too. If you fail he'll let you have some larva-love. Try to prevent this. If you hit him while he's on ceiling he'll fall and you'll have enough time to hit his eye again a few times. Repeat this once again and you should have him dead.
- Take the heart container and step into the blue light. You'll be outside of the Deku Tree.
- Watch the cut scenes, follow the story. Link can no longer stay in the village. Saria meets you on the exit ( eastern path on the map) and let's you have her Ocarina. Your journey begins!
Hyrule Castle
- Welcome to the Hyrule Fields. Finish the talk with the owl and follow the easy pathway to the castle. Check your map if you don't know where the castle is. You can only enter it during the day, during the night you'll just have to stay away from evil zombie-like creatures. They can be quite dangerous but if you stay on the dirt path they won't come close to you. Once the castle's doors are down enter it.
- You're in the Hyrule Castle Market now. Walk around a bit, you'll find a shop with the Hylian Shield. DON'T BUY IT... yet. You'll get a discount later. A girl in the center of the market, Malon will tell you how her dad hasn't returned home from castle for some long time. While you're here don't forget to visit Shooting Gallery. Play the mini-game to get Deku Seed Bullet Bag upgrade. If you ever need more rupees, there's a room near the entrance of the castle where you can hit the vases infinite times for lots of rupees.
- Heart Piece During the night a woman in back alley will be looking for her dog. Go to the market area and get close to the gray dog, just below the open window. He'll follow you. Go back to the woman and claim your prize.
- Enter the pathway to the Castle. Watch the cut scene. Immediately go back to the Market. Back to the Castle again. Malon will be standing by the vines. You get an Egg from her. Now, climb the vines and drop into the hole with the ladder. Exit the door. Go all the way up but beware of the guards. Go all the way left so that you don't come into their line of sight. Head across the area covered with grass to the wall which has more vines on it. Climb it, go a bit further to the castle and drop into the water. Swim all the way to the castle's right side and climb onto the shore. You'll see a man sleeping there. If the Chicken has hatched, then use the chicken near him. If not, wait a bit longer. it usually takes a day for the chicken to hatch. Watch the cutscene. Move the blocks so you can enter the castle. Make sure it's daytime.
- You need to get to the princess now but many guards will stand in your way. 5 areas actually. Just be sure to time your movements well. Walk behind them and always care of the other guards - if they are not alone. Once you go through the fifth guard-crowded area you get to meet the princess Zelda. Watch the cut scenes, meet Ganondorf the main villain in the Zelda universe and learn Zelda's Lullaby. Now it's time to go to Kakariko but there's an optional quest for you.
- Epona's Song and Heart Piece: You need to visit Lon Lon Ranch located in the middle of the Hyrule Field. When entering the place, go towards the coral, then to the left and roll into the tree for a Skulltula to fall down. Get the token. Now enter the ranch. Take the door to the left. Speak to Talon and play the mini-game. After you have won the mini-game you get a bottle of Lon Lon Milk. Now go out, and to the central place of the ranch. Talk to Melon and she'll get you acquainted with Epona. Epona will be scared but after you learn the Epona's Song you'll be able to use the horse later in the game. With this song and a bottle any cow in the game will give you free Lon Lon milk. To get the Heart Piece go to the southwest corner of Lon Lon Ranch, enter the place and find the piece behind the boxes.
- Exit the ranch and make your way to the town of Kakariko - north-east on the map.
Kakariko Village
- Once you're in the village feel free to lurk around a bit.
- OPTIONAL The first house on the right is the House of Skulltula. Here, you can talk with Skulltulas. One will tell you that if you kill enough golden Skulltulas and bring their tokens to this place you'll get pretty rich. Actually, for every 10 golden tokens you'll get a reward, that is, until you collect 50 of them. If you are up to it, and get to collect all 100 that can be found throughout the game, you get the biggest of all rewards. More about this in the Sidequest section in the end of the walkthrough.
- OPTIONAL Talk to Anju near Impa's House. She'll ask you to collect her chickens. The first one is right by her. Pick it up and throw it into the pen. One is near the Death Mountain pathway. Pick it up and run across the top of the house close to the watchtower, jump off the end, and fly over to the fence near the Skulltula House to reach the third chicken. Throw both chickens off the ledge and take them to their pen. Next one is near the entrance to Kakariko and the sixth one stays hidden in a crate left of the entrance. Roll and break the crate. Grab the sixth one and jump off the ledge towards the rust colored house with the small fence. Throw the chicken the way you came from and climb the ladder. Collect the seventh and last chicken. Grab him, throw him over the fence and once you're on the other side collect both and get them in their pen. Once you've collected all seven you get an Empty Bottle.
- It's time to visit Kakariko Graveyard. The pathway is located right of the windmill. Go to the back of the graveyard and play Zelda's Lullaby near the big grave. Lightning bolt will hit the ground. Enter the hole.
- Kill all the monsters in the first room. The door will unlock. Enter the next room. Now careful around the monsters in this area. For now, you can't kill them. Just run to the other side of the room and read the inscription. You'll learn the Sun's Song. With it you can turn the night into day and vice-versa. Also, you can calm dead with it - freeze the monsters in this area and also some which you will encounter later in the game. Exit the crypt.
- Heart Piece: If you come to the graveyard between 18:00 and 21:00 you can play a grave-digging mini-game. Speak to the grave keeper and he'll explain how the tour works. You'll usually get a green or blue rupee, but sometimes you can get a red rupee worth 20. However if you dig where there's soil on the ground ( right of the royal tomb ) you'll find a Heart Piece.
- Talk to the guard on the gate behind which lies the pathway to Death Mountains. Show him the letter which princess gave to you before. He'll allow you to pass but before you do that, make sure to equip yourself with a Hylian Shield. You can get one in the Hyrule Market shop. You should also pick up the mask which guard requests for. It can be found in the Happy Mask Shop located in Hyrule Market. Bring it to him to get a 5 rupee profit. It will allow you to get many important upgrades and extras later in the game. Once you have the Hylian Shield equip it and proceed to the Death Mountain Trail.
- Follow the trail. Talk to the Gorons which you meet on the way to the top. You'll get to a fork. There's a large path to the left which you cannot take for now. Follow the small path to the right. You'll pass a circular group of stones. Beyond them lies the entrance to the Goron City.
Goron City
- When you enter the Goron City you'll come across many Gorons willing to talk. Most are usually sleepy or hungry. Get to the bottom floor by either jumping from top or by finding the stairs on each floor.
- Head for a room which has a rug in front of the door. It's locked. Play the Zelda's Lullaby while standing on the to get the door opened. Once inside, talk to the chief Darunia. He's in bad mood, oh well...
- Light a Deku Stick with the help of the torch in Darunia's room. Get outside and light the other torches. This causes the central jar to rotate and music to play. Light the bomb flowers so that you can enter the Goron shop. Nothing much here though.
- On the second level of the city you'll be able to find some boulders surrounded by bomb flowers. Light them up to open the pathway.

Lost Woods
- Listen to the owl. Kaporea will tell you that the right way through the forest is found by listening to tunes. Only one way is the right one and that's the one where you can hear the song playing when you get close to it. Enter the right pathways a few times and you'll get into the Secret Forest Meadow.
- After entering the meadow you'll get to a closed gate. Approach it and you'll get attacked by a Wolfos. Defeat the monster and the path opens. Now, use shield to defend yourself from the well-known enemies and proceed to the next area. There will be two of these guarding the stairway. Deal with them and meet Saria. She'll teach you the Saria's Song.
- Go back and up the ladder to bypass the labyrinth. Jump into the hole in the middle to discover Fairy Fountain. You can continue with the story now or do some optional questing in the woods.
- OPTIONAL Go to any crossing in the woods and take the wrong path to get into Kokiri Forest. Now turn back and enter woods. Take the left path. Skull Kid is playing and dancing on a stump. Left again. You'll find yourself in the area with the bridge. Climb down the ladder and proceed to the area with a spilling monster. Use shield to reflect and catch him. Pay 40 rupees for the Deku Sticks upgrade.
- OPTIONAL Now get back to the room with Skull Kid and take the right path - to the Kokiri entrance, but go straight-forward. Use your slingshot to hit the thing hanging from the tree 3 times - hit the center. A Scrub appears and lets you have a Deku Seeds upgrade.
- Heart Piece: Below that place, a stump can be found. Stand on it. More Skull Kids appear. Use the Ocarina. Play what Skull Kids play. Repeat the process 3 times to get a Heart piece.
- Heart Piece: Go back to the place where the first Skull Kid was. Get onto the lower stump, and take out your Ocarina. He'll be amazed. Play the Saria's Song. You're awarded with a Heart Piece.
